I wonder if I could pick your brains once again? I have tried my best at trying to diagnose the problem myself but seem to have hit a brick wall…
I have a 52 plate 2.6 70k miles and just recently it has developed a noise under the bonnet. It’s hard to describe exactly what it sounds like so I have included a link to an mp3 recording of it, oh the wonders of modern technology! The recording was taken from my Zen MP3 player which was positioned next to the oil filter as this seemed to be clearest position.
Anyway a rattling noise can be heard quite clearly at tick over but soon dies away as the engine revs up and drowns the rattling out. I don’t think it’s from either of the heads, nor either of the exhaust manifolds or manifold/down pipe gaskets. The problem seems to come from the lower part of the engine around the gearbox/sump area??
The timing belt kit was changed at 44k but this was of the Goodyear brand and not GM. The Goodyear reminder sticker under the bonnet states that a full timing belt kit was fitted.
I am really stumped on what this could be as my knowledge of the V6 engine is very minimal. So any input on this would be a godsend.
